3. SCREW DRIVER SAFETY
WARNINGS
1. BE SURE TO KEEP HANDS AWAY FROM
THE TRIGGER SWITCH AND LOCK THE
TRIGGER SWITH AND REMOVE THE
BATTERY PACK AND COLLATED
SCREW WHEN REPLACING OR ADJUST-
ING THE BIT, CHECKING, ADJUSTING
OR MAINTAINING THE TOOL, REMOV-
ING A JAMMED SCREW, WHEN ABNOR-
MALITIES OCCUR AND WHEN THE TOOL
IS NOT BEING USED.
Leaving the Battery pack installed in these sit-
uations may cause breakdowns or damage.
2. BE SURE TO KEEP HANDS AWAY FROM
THE TRIGGER SWITCH AND LOCK THE
TRIGGER SWITH AND REMOVE THE BAT-
TERY PACK WHEN LOADING COLLATED
SCREW. BE SURE TO KEEP HANDS
AWAY FROM THE TRIGGER SWITCH AND
LOCK THE TRIGGER SWITH WHEN RE-
PLACING THE BATTERY PACK.
Failure to do so may result in serious injury.
3. HOLD TOOL BY INSULATED GRIPS
WHEN PERFORMING AN OPERATION,
BECAUSE THE TOOL'S BIT MAY CON-
TACT HIDDEN "LIVE" WIRE.
Contacting with a "live" wire may make ex-
posed metal parts of the tool "electrified" and
shock the operator. Failure to do so may re-
sult in serious injury.
4. DO NOT POINT THE TOOL AT ANYONE.
Personal injury may result if the tool catches
an operator or anyone working near him.
While working with the tool, be extremely
careful not to bring hands, legs, and other
body parts near the bit of the tool.
5. NEVER MODIFY THE TOOL.
Modifying the tool will impair performance and
operating safety. Any modification may lead to
serious injury and void the tool warranty.
6. NEVER DISASSEMBLE THE TOOL.
If the tool does not function properly, contact
your distributor for inspection and repairs.
7. CHECK THE FOLLOWING BEFORE USE
(SEE PAGE 16)
• Wear in the bit.
• Damaged parts or loose screws.
• Movement of the trigger switch, rotational
direction switch and nose.
• Generated heat, odors, or unusual sounds
when attaching the battery.
8. MAKE SURE TO OPERATE THE TOOL ON
A FIRM FOOTING.
Failure to do so may lead to serious injury.
9. MAKE SURE THERE IS NO ONE BELOW
WHEN USING THE TOOL IN HIGH LOCA-
TIONS.
Failure to do so may lead to serious injury of
the person below.
10. KEEP HANDS AWAY FROM ALL MOVING
PARTS.
11. DO NOT INSERT YOUR FINGER IN THE
OPENING OF THE NOSE UPPER SURFACE.
12. DO NOT TOUCH THE BIT OR PARTS
CLOSE TO THE BIT IMMEDIATELY AF-
TER OPERATION.
These parts may be extremely hot. Touching
these parts may cause serious injury.
13. DO NOT DRIVE FASTENERS ON TOP OF
OTHER FASTENERS.
Driving fasteners on the top of other fasten-
ers may cause deflection fasteners which
could cause injury.
14. KEEP THE TOOL'S HAND GRIP DRY AND
CLEAN, ESPECIALLY FREE OF OIL AND
GREASE.
15. KEEP THE TOOL AWAY FROM HEAT
AND FRAME.
16. USE ONLY GENUINE BIT AND REPLACE-
MENT PARTS.
17. DO NOT OPERATE THE TOOL UNDER
ANY ABNORMAL CONDITION.
If the tool is not in good working order, or if
any abnormal condition is noticed, switch it
off immediately and ask our dealer for in-
spection and repair.
18. STORE THE TOOL IN LOCKED PLACE
AND OUT OF THE REACH OF CHILDREN
WHEN IT IS NOT BEING USED.
19. USE ONLY THE AUTHORIZED BATTERY
PACK.
Use only MAX JPL91430A battery pack. If
the tool is connected to a power supply other
than the authorized pack, such as a re-
chargeable battery, a dry cell, or a storage
battery for use in automobiles, the tool may
be damaged, break down, overheat, or even
catch on fire. Do not connect this tool to any
power supply except the MAX JPL91430A
battery pack.
